Society For Nigerian Women To Hold Demonstration If Mercy Johnson Proceeds With Wedding

A women's group, Society for Nigerian Women, have written to Christ Embassy that if the Church goes ahead with the wedding despite all the evidences and petitions of Lovely against the wedding that they would mobilize Nigerian women to demonstrate and disrupt the wedding proceedings.

The letter addressed directly to Pastor Chris Oyakilome dated August 15th and  signed by Mrs. Chinyere Okonkwo President of the group indicated that after the meeting of the group on August 13th, they’ve decided to react to publications that were reporting that Pastor Chris lead church has finally agreed to go ahead with the wedding, it described the decisions as wicked and highly immoral that a man will leave his legally married wife and go ahead to marry another woman and a respectable church were ready to join them together.

The letter begged Pastor Chris to rescind the decisions in the interest of the innocent children that Odi had abandoned or risk 5,000 women demonstrating in front of the Church on the day of the wedding.
